The Classical Method of soil testing for consolidation was developed by Karl Terzaghi. Consolidation occurs when a pressure is applied to a soil whereby water is squeezed out but the space is not replaced by air.

What is coefficient of consolidation?

Coefficient of consolidation (Cv) is a measure of time it takes for a soil to consolidate during the lab test.

What are the importance of the consolidation test?

The consolidation test is crucial in geotechnical engineering as it assesses the compressibility and settlement characteristics of soil under load. It measures the rate and magnitude of soil consolidation, providing insights into how soil will behave when subjected to structures or changes in loading conditions. This information is essential for predicting potential settlement issues and ensuring the stability and safety of foundations. Additionally, it aids in the design of appropriate foundations and other ground improvement techniques.

Was John A Larson the only inventor of the lie detector test?

No, John A. Larson was not the only inventor of the lie detector test. While he is credited with developing the modern polygraph in the 1920s, other inventors, such as William M. Marston, also contributed to the concept of measuring physiological responses to determine truthfulness. Larson's work built on earlier ideas and technologies, making him a significant figure in the development of the lie detector but not the sole inventor.
